Chapter 31

Shigure sat alone in his room with his head cocked back against the wall. His eyes watched the darkness creep by as his thoughts drift into his past memories. Whispers of past conversations haunted him in the deepest part of his mind.

'Would you do it Shigure? For me?'

'I would, we would never betray you. You're our god Akito. We don't know this girl, let her stay and perhaps we can make good use of her.'

'Fine, but you're the one responsible for this Shigure, not me. I will not be a pawn in your own foolish games.'

'Akito…I have plenty of pawns.'

Shigure brought his hand up to cover part of his face. His eyes filled with his own salty tears as his nails dug into his delicate flesh, "What have I done? If something happens to them…I would never be able to forgive myself especially if it was Tohru…"

Just as Shigure felt like he had lost himself completely in his self pity, his eyes caught sight of the Chinese Zodiac calendar he had tucked away in his room. He had planned on giving it to Tohru after the banquet, but with the recent events the involved Kyo he hadn't been able to find the appropriate time to give her the gift. Shigure dropped his hand down to his lap as he just stared into his hands, "As the dog I will prove my loyalty again, one day even god will see my compassion. I showed my teeth, but I will see this to the end."

Kyo rolled over slightly on his side feeling the warmth of the morning rays against his thin body. His orange hair was ruffled into a mess as he sat up rubbing his eyes, "Wha...wasn't I sleeping on the floor?"

"You were, but Tohru insisted that we place you back in your bed," Shigure said as his eyes poked out from behind the morning's paper, "And Yuki made me do all the work."

Kyo gave Shigure one of his more annoyed looks as he propped himself up on one of his elbows. He disliked that thought of Shigure holding him it made him feel ill, "Why the hell are you sitting in my room?"

Shigure set his paper down with a serious look. He cleared his throat slightly as he slowly opened his mouth, "Because…I enjoy watching our young prince sleep! Yet a lonely prince just won't do, he needs his princess at his side in his bed."

Kyo immediately grabbed his pillows and what ever else he could grab to throw at Shigure, "What the hell is wrong with you! Don't say those things out loud."

Shigure laughed lightly before one of the pillows hit him in the face, knocking him off his seat, "Ow, Kyo's being mean this morning."

"Damn, right! Now get out of my room you perverted dog!"

Shigure crawled for the door, but before he did he looked over his shoulder, "Why are you here Kyo?"

"Huh? What sort of questions is that? Are you getting philosophical on me? Because if you are I'm not going to waste my breath on you if you're going to act like a dumbass, I mean-"

"Uh, no I didn't mean that," Shigure pointed to Kyo's clock on his stand, "I was just wondering why you're not in school."

Kyo blinked lightly before he looked at his clock. His face went white as he realized how late it was, "Ahh! I'm almost 3 hours late. Why didn't anyone wake me up!"

Shigure laughed nervously as he got back up on his feet rubbing his nose slightly from the pillow hitting him in the face, "Kyo, don't you remember last year when we tried waking you up? You destroyed part of my house and I can't bear to see that happen again."

"You dumbass! Who cares about your house, what about me?" Kyo yelled as he frantically jumped out of bed looking for his school uniform while he tried to fix his hair and brush his teeth. The entire time Shigure was just standing in the doorway watching Kyo run from one side of his room to the other.

"Kids these days. They have no respect for their elder's houses," Shigure said as he began to pout. He held his hands up like a dog begging for attention.

Kyo paused in the middle of the room staring at Shigure with narrowed eyes, warning Shigure to leave him alone. Shigure just waved at Kyo happily before he ran out the door with Kyo chasing after him, "You're no elder and stop watching me!"

Once Shigure was gone, Kyo slammed his door shut and got his uniform on. He was quick in changing his cloths even with his injury. Once he was done he grabbed his bag and ran out the door. His hair was still ruffled in spots but it was good enough for now.

Shigure watched Kyo run frantically for school. He could tell that Kyo was trying to jam some food as fast as he could in his mouth while he was running, "My isn't that cute, I think I'll tell Hari!"

"Kyo? Are you ok?" Tohru asked as they walked home together, "You don't look to well."

"What!" Kyo yelled a bit startled from being interrupted from his thoughts, "I mean…no I'm fine. I was just thinking was all."

"If you need to rest…"

"I said I was fine and I mean it," Kyo said as he brushed his bangs aside.

"Look Kyo," Tohru said as she pointed to one of the trees. She was obvious not bothered by Kyo's harsher remarks since she knew he didn't mean anything by it, but Kyo always regretted the things that came out of his mouth sometimes. He just couldn't control it all the time, "The flowers are beginning to bloom. When they all bloom we'll be graduating. Isn't it exacting?"

Kyo looked up at the small tiny blossom, "Yeah…it is. Have you thought about what you will do after school?"

"I…don't know. I suppose I could get a job and work. I promised mom I would graduate high school, but college is too expensive for me and I don't think I'm exactly smart enough to get in."

"But you're not any of those things! And maybe the Sohma's can help."

"I couldn't accept that…" Tohru said as she waved her hands, "You and the Sohma's have given me too much already. A house over my head and food three times a day. That's all I ask."

Kyo wanted to argue some more about this since he didn't want Tohru to end up at some low life job. He wanted to give her the best and it frustrated him that he had so little to offer her. He grabbed her by the wrist just as she walked past him. He brought her close to his body as he whispered into her ear, "Then promise me to stay with me. Just one last promise."

Tohru felt her body press against Kyo's for the first time without a sudden explosion of smoke. Her head rested against his chest as his heart beat with steady rhythm echoing in her ears. The warmth of his body was comforting as she wrapped her arms around him, "I promise."

Kyo wasn't surprise he didn't transform. Deep down he knew that the curse on his body was lifted. His chin rested against her head as his arms kept his close to his body. The sweet smell of strawberries surrounded his senses as he shut his eyes slightly. Despite this peaceful moment Kyo still felt the curse on his mind. While the curse didn't change his body it didn't mean it was dead. Perhaps it was waiting for a chance to destroy the Sohma's once again. Kyo didn't care, because he had all he wanted and he had no more concerns for anything else. He knew Tohru's promise was genuine and one day he would be able to take her as his own. For now he was just content enough to be able to touch her with his hands as they both hugged each other close.

The two blossoms that rested in the tree above had begun to bloom, but will the flowers be able to flourish and live the rest of their lives in peace or will the flowers succumb to the dangers around them?
